Understanding High Strength Full Thread Bolts
High strength full thread bolts are designed to withstand significant loads and stresses, making them ideal for critical applications. Unlike standard bolts, these fasteners feature threads that run the entire length of the shaft, allowing for enhanced grip and clamping force.
Key Characteristics of High Strength Full Thread Bolts
1. **Material Composition**: Typically made from high-tensile materials such as alloy steel, these bolts exhibit exceptional strength and durability.
2. **Corrosion Resistance**: Many high strength full thread bolts are coated with materials to prevent rust and corrosion, ensuring longevity in harsh environments.
3. **Precision Manufacturing**: High standards in manufacturing processes ensure that these bolts meet specific dimensions and tolerances for optimal performance.
Applications in the Construction Industry
The construction industry is one of the largest users of high strength full thread bolts. These bolts are critical for ensuring structural integrity in buildings and infrastructure projects.
1. Structural Steel Connections
High strength full thread bolts are extensively used in the assembly of steel structures. Their ability to secure beams, columns, and trusses effectively enables the construction of skyscrapers, bridges, and other large-scale constructions.
2. Precast Concrete Elements
In precast concrete construction, these bolts facilitate the connection between precast elements, ensuring stability while accommodating expansion and contraction due to temperature changes.
3. Heavy Equipment Foundations
High strength full thread bolts anchor heavy equipment to their foundations, providing the necessary support and stability to withstand vibrations and dynamic forces.
Significance in the Automotive Industry
The automotive industry relies heavily on high strength full thread bolts for various applications, from assembly to safety components.
1. Engine Assembly
These bolts are critical in engine block assembly, where they secure components under high stress and temperature. Their strength ensures the integrity of the engine throughout its operational life.
2. Chassis and Suspension Systems
High strength full thread bolts play a vital role in the assembly of chassis and suspension systems. Their durability is crucial for maintaining vehicle safety and performance, especially in high-performance and heavy-duty vehicles.
Role in Aerospace Applications
The aerospace industry demands the highest standards of safety and reliability. High strength full thread bolts are integral to various applications within this sector.
1. Aircraft Frame Assembly
These bolts are used to secure the aircraft frame, providing strength and stability while contributing to the overall weight reduction crucial for flight performance.
2. Engine Mountings
High strength full thread bolts ensure secure engine mountings, which are critical for minimizing vibrations and maintaining alignment during flight operations.
Utilization in Marine Engineering
Marine applications require fasteners that can withstand harsh environments, including saltwater exposure. High strength full thread bolts are well-suited for these conditions.
1. Shipbuilding
In shipbuilding, these bolts connect various structural components, ensuring durability and resistance to corrosion. Their use is fundamental in maintaining the integrity of the vessel over time.
2. Offshore Platforms
For offshore oil rigs and platforms, high strength full thread bolts secure equipment and structures against harsh marine conditions, ensuring operational safety and efficiency.

Common Materials Used for High Strength Full Thread Bolts
The effectiveness of high strength full thread bolts largely depends on the materials used in their construction.
1. Alloy Steel
Commonly used for high strength applications, alloy steel provides excellent tensile strength and durability.
2. Stainless Steel
Stainless steel bolts are favored for their corrosion resistance, making them suitable for marine and chemical applications.
